logo

Output 2500131214c617446be21a19fa030494b6c2c906247fec04e98d2334c20463a4:5

value
14500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 354c6cb48897b4480fe75561dccf7843e26e7fe6 OP_EQUALVERIFY OP_CHECKSIG
address
15rpNF7iqYzBJhju87xEVbrxbCVuc8VbNk
transaction
2500131214c617446be21a19fa030494b6c2c906247fec04e98d2334c20463a4